Baptist Health is the largest healthcare system serving central Alabama, providing comprehensive hospital-based and outpatient services to nearly 60 percent of the residents in Montgomery, Autauga and Elmore counties.
The Patient Registration Specialist shall be responsible for pre-registration, registration, payer identification and verification, referral to financial counseling, and point of service collections. The Specialist shall be responsible to ensure that data gathered and entered to the computer system(s) of patient demographic and benefit information is accurate. The Specialist shall verify benefits eligibility and limitations, coordination of benefits, as well as to determine and collect the patient's financial responsibility at the point of service. Additionally, the Specialist shall have an understanding of regulatory requirements (medical necessity determination, Medicare Secondary Payer completion and coordination of benefits, Important Message from Medicare issuance and signage, HIPAA, and EMTALA).
